Step 1: Confirm the Problem Before You Assume Anything

Before you touch a single setting, make sure the oven temperature not accurate issue is real and not a one-off from a single bad bake. Ovens can seem inconsistent for reasons that have nothing to do with calibration — a drafty kitchen, a door that gets opened too often, or a recipe written for a different type of oven entirely.

Run this simple test:

  1. Buy an independent oven thermometer — a basic analog or digital dial model works fine — and set it in the center of the middle rack.

  2. Preheat to 350°F, then let it finish preheating and stabilize for an extra 15 minutes.

  3. Read the thermometer through the door window if you can; otherwise open briefly and check fast.

  4. Repeat the reading every 10–15 minutes across a full hour, so you capture how much the temperature swings, not just where it lands once.

If the reading sits more than 25°F off from 350°F, or swings 30–40 degrees during the hour, your problem is confirmed and worth fixing.

Step 2: Is Your Oven Running Hot or Cold?

Whether your oven temperature is not accurate in the hot or the cold direction changes what's likely wrong — and how you should adjust in the meantime.

Your oven runs hot if:

  • Baked goods brown too fast on top while staying raw inside

  • You constantly have to shorten cook times from what the recipe says

  • Food burns at the edges before the center is done

Your oven runs cold if:

  • Food takes noticeably longer than the recipe suggests

  • Baked goods come out pale or doughy in the middle

  • Roasts and casseroles need extra time to reach a safe internal temperature

Knowing the direction lets you compensate right away (more on that below) while you track down the real cause.

Step 3: The Most Common Causes, Ranked by Likelihood

An oven temperature not accurate problem almost always traces back to one of these five, roughly in order of how often we see them:

  1. Thermostat drift (most common). Every oven's thermostat loses accuracy gradually with age and use. This is normal wear, not a defect — it's exactly why manufacturers build in a calibration setting.

  2. A worn or failing temperature sensor. This small probe on the back or side wall reads the cavity temperature and reports it to the control board. Age, grease buildup, or a sensor that has shifted position (even lightly touching the wall) can throw readings off badly.

  3. Door seal problems. A gasket that's torn, flattened, or not sealing lets heat leak out continuously. The oven overcompensates by cycling the element more often, which produces swings rather than steady heat.

  4. Uneven heating element wear. Bake and broil elements degrade over years of use. A weakening bake element usually makes the oven run cooler than the dial suggests, since it can't fully reach the target in a normal cycle.   5. Calibration that was never set for your unit. Some ovens ship slightly miscalibrated, and unless a previous owner or installer corrected it, that error has been there since day one.

Step 4: How to Recalibrate Your Oven Yourself

Correcting an oven temperature not accurate reading is, most of the time, just a calibration tweak — and most ovens built in the last 15–20 years have the adjustment built in. The general process (exact steps vary by brand):

  1. Press and hold Bake and Broil together for a few seconds, or check your manual for the right combination — this usually opens a hidden settings menu.

  2. Find the setting labeled Temp Adjust, Oven Offset, or Calibration.

  3. Enter the difference your thermometer showed. If the oven read 375°F when set to 350°F, enter -25 to bring it back in line.

  4. Save, then re-run the Step 1 thermometer test to confirm the adjustment worked.

Most ovens only allow adjustments within a limited range (often ±35°F). If your error is bigger than that, calibration alone won't fully fix it — a component is more likely at fault. If you can't find the calibration menu, searching your exact model number plus "temperature calibration" usually turns up the manufacturer's button sequence.

Step 5: Compensating While You Diagnose the Real Cause

If the problem isn't fixed yet and you still need to cook tonight, here's a rough workaround: if your oven runs 25°F hot, set it 25 degrees lower than the recipe calls for and check food a few minutes early. It isn't a permanent solution, but it saves the meal while you sort out calibration or a repair.

Convection Ovens: A Different Set of Variables

Convection ovens circulate air with a fan, and a few extra factors can make the oven temperature not accurate problem worse or harder to diagnose:

  • A weak or failing convection fan motor prevents even heat distribution, creating hot and cold spots instead of a uniform reading.

  • Many recipes already assume a 25°F reduction for convection mode. If you're not accounting for that, the oven may not be miscalibrated at all.

  • Vents or fan blades coated in grease reduce airflow over time and are worth cleaning during regular maintenance.

When Calibration Isn't Enough: Signs You Need a Repair

Recalibrating fixes a consistent offset, but it can't fix a temperature that swings unpredictably or an error too large for the built-in range. Consider a professional inspection if:

  • The oven needs more than ±35°F of correction to read accurately

  • The temperature swings more than 30–40°F during a single bake, even after calibration

  • You notice a burning smell, an unusual noise, or visible damage to the heating element

  • The oven takes far longer than normal to preheat, hinting at a failing element or sensor

Preventing This From Happening Again

A little upkeep keeps an oven temperature not accurate problem from creeping back:

  • Re-check calibration roughly once a year, especially after a move or if baking results have been drifting.

  • Keep the door gasket clean and inspect it for tears or flattening every few months.

  • Avoid opening the oven door frequently mid-bake — each opening dumps heat and forces the thermostat to work harder to recover.

  • Clean the temperature sensor gently with a damp cloth now and then, without bending or repositioning the probe.

Frequently Asked Questions

How do I know if my oven temperature is not accurate?

Place an independent oven thermometer on the middle rack, preheat to 350°F, and let it stabilize for 15 extra minutes. If it reads more than 25°F off, or swings 30–40 degrees over an hour, your oven is inaccurate and worth adjusting.

Why is my oven not reaching the set temperature?

An oven that runs cold usually has thermostat drift, a worn temperature sensor, or a weakening bake element that can't fully heat the cavity. A torn door gasket that leaks heat can also keep it from holding temperature. Start with a thermometer test, then try recalibration.

Can I recalibrate my oven myself?

Yes. Most ovens from the last 15–20 years have a Temp Adjust, Oven Offset, or Calibration setting, usually reached by holding Bake and Broil together. Enter the difference your thermometer showed (for example, -25 if it ran 25°F hot) and re-test.

How far off is an oven allowed to be?

Manufacturers generally consider up to about 25°F of variance acceptable, since ovens cycle heat on and off around the target. Beyond that — or if the temperature swings wildly rather than settling — it's worth calibrating or having the sensor and element checked.

Why does my oven temperature keep fluctuating?

Wide swings usually point to a failing door gasket, a shifted or aging temperature sensor, or a heating element that isn't firing consistently. Calibration corrects a steady offset but not swings, so persistent fluctuation is a sign the oven needs a professional diagnosis.

Is it worth repairing an oven with inaccurate temperature?

Often, yes. A new temperature sensor or gasket is an inexpensive, quick repair. As a rule of thumb, if the fix costs less than about half the price of a comparable new oven, repair usually makes sense — especially for built-in or high-end models.

Does opening the oven door affect the temperature?

Yes. Each time you open the door, a significant amount of heat escapes and the oven has to work to recover, which can add cook time and look like inaccuracy. Use the window and light instead of opening the door to check on food.
